We are a couple of days away until Britney Spears releases her new single Pretty Girls and the suspense is killing us! While we wait for the single to come out, NYPOST.com created a ranking from best to worst, of artist Britney Spears collaborated with.




While we await the answers, let’s placate ourselves with a trip down memory lane to definitively rank each and every one of Britney’s collaborations — those tracks where another artist is credited with a feature, or Britney is the featured artist. From best to worst, let’s give them a listen — baby, one more time.


1. ‘Me Against the Music’ feat. Madonna




But of course, Britney’s best collaboration is — and likely always will be — with Madonna. The tour-de-force pairing of the Princess of Pop and the Queen of Pop was not only a passing of the baton, it was a genuine feat of musical decadence — a moment in history that can never be repeated.

2. ‘I Got That (Boom Boom)’ feat. the Ying Yang Twins




One of Britney’s most underrated tracks, “Boom Boom” features a down-and-dirty beat that had fans twerking before we even knew what that was.

3. ‘Boys’ (The Co-Ed Remix) feat. Pharrell




Before Pharrell was very “Happy,” he was the boy to Brit’s girl in the ultimate ode to hooking up on the dance floor.

4. ‘SMS (Bangerz)’ by Miley Cyrus feat. Britney Spears




Britney’s drive-by appearance on the track was fully thanks to the two stars’ shared manager. Regardless, the quirky song is nothing if not original, featuring Britney in rare form as a high-octane scene-stealer.

5. ‘Scream & Shout’ by will.i.am feat. Britney Spears




The most successful of will.i.am and Britney’s dealings smartly employed Britney’s “Gimme More” catchphrase — “It’s Britney, bitch” — and amped it up to the next level.

6. ‘Crazy’ by Kevin Federline feat. Britney Spears




“WHAT?” you exclaim. “Britney had a song with K-Fed?!”

“WHAT?” you exclaim again. “You’ve placed it in the top half of this list?”

Yes, yes, we have. Not to be confused with “(You Drive Me) Crazy,” this song appeared on K-Fed’s iconic 2006 album, “Playing With Fire.” It’s a certifiable jam that would be at home on any Top 40 radio station today.
